Solution Overview

Problem

Manual configuration and credential management for cloud-based storage resources is prone to errors and requires frequent manual updates, leading to inefficiencies and potential access issues.

Innovation Solution

Automated retrieval and management of cloud-based storage credentials through a cloud management infrastructure, allowing for on-demand access and propagation of credentials for computing and storage resources, reducing human error and administrative workload.

Data Source

PatentUS8468352B2Retrieving and using cloud based storage credentials
Publication Date: 2013.06.18 MICROSOFT TECHNOLOGY LICENSING LLC

AI summary

The present invention extends to methods, systems, and computer program products for retrieving and using cloud based storage credentials. Embodiments of the invention include automatically retrieving cloud based credentials (e.g., storage keys) as needed, such as, for example, on demand. Automatically retrieving credentials reduces administrator workloads and mitigates the potential for human errors. Embodiments of the invention also include using credentials (e.g., storage keys) in the deployment and ongoing operation of services (e.g., computing workers) in a resource cloud. Embodiments of the invention also include propagating credentials (e.g., storage keys) to instances running in the cloud during deployment.
